Pelister got points from Ohrid Lote match, officially promoted
Pelister received the 3 points from the match against Ohrid Lote two rounds ago when the visitors failed to show up, and thus the club from Bitola was officially promoted to the First League.

Macedonian First League – Round 30
Vardar noted a 1:2 win in Kratovo against Sileks and officially clinched the league title in the 20th edition of the Macedonian Championship.
U21 Qualifier: Macedonia – Northern Ireland 1:0
Macedonia U21 noted a minimal 1:0 home victory over its counterparts from Northern Ireland in a U21 qualifier played today in Kumanovo.

Vardar and Shkendija without licenses for European matches
Vardar and Shkendija were not granted licenses for European matches next season, the Football Federation of Macedonia (FFM) reported today.
Macedonia to play friendly with Angola
The football federations of Macedonia and Angola have arranged a friendly match to be played on the 29th of May in Portugal, Angola Press reported.
